Community Health Tips

  • Check NHSC loan repayment eligibility for your site (hpsa.hrsa.gov)
  • FQHCs provide malpractice coverage under FTCA — a major benefit
  • Expect higher patient volumes (16-22/day) but broader scope
  • Bilingual skills are highly valued and may qualify for pay differentials
  • Community health experience is excellent for future leadership roles

What qualifications do I need for community health PMHNP jobs?

To work as a PMHNP in Peoria, you need: a Master's or Doctoral degree in psychiatric-mental health nursing, ANCC PMHNP-BC certification, an active RN and APRN license in Arizona, and DEA registration for prescribing controlled substances.
